If secure to do so, take the chemical container to the telephone. The product label gives clinical workers information such as energetic components, an antidote, and an emergency call number for the maker.


If you need to go to the health center or doctor's office, take the entire pesticide container, consisting of the label, with you. To avoid inhaling fumes or spilling the materials, make certain the container is tightly secured and place right into a plastic bag preferably. The chemical container must never be put in the enclosed passenger section of your automobile.




Inhalation of spray haze or dust from these chemicals may trigger throat irritation, sneezing, and coughing. Persistent exposures to reduced concentrations of fungicides can create unfavorable health effects.

Generally, herbicides have a low acute toxicity to humans since the physiology of plants is so various than that of human beings. However, there are exceptions; numerous can be facial irritants given that they are frequently strong acids, amines, esters, and phenols. Breathing of spray haze might create coughing and a burning sensation in the nasal flows and breast.

The most serious pesticide poisonings normally arise from intense exposure to organophosphate and carbamate insecticides.


The carbamate compounds include carbaryl, carbofuran, methomyl, and oxamyl. Organophosphates and carbamates inhibit the enzyme cholinesterase, creating a disruption of the nervous system. All life creates with cholinesterase in their nerve system, such as pests, fish, birds, human beings, and various other animals, can be poisoned by these chemicals. To comprehend how the organophosphate and carbamate insecticides affect the nerve system, one requires to recognize exactly how the nerve system actually works.


Messages or electrical impulses (stimulations) take a trip along this complex network of cells. Afferent neuron or neurons do not physically touch each various other; instead there is a gap or synapse between cells. The impulses have to go across or "bridge" the synapse between nerve cells in order to maintain the message moving along the whole network.

Acetylcholine is the main chemical responsible for the transmission of nerve impulses across the synapse of two nerve cells. Organophosphate and carbamate insecticides inhibit the task of cholinesterase, resulting in a i loved this build-up of acetylcholine in the body.


The nervous system comes to be "infected"; the build-up of acetylcholine causes the continual transmission of impulses throughout the synapses. The effects of organophosphate or carbamate poisoning can cause both systemic and topical signs. Direct direct exposure of the eye, as an example, can create topical signs such as tightness of the students, blurry vision, a brow frustration, and serious irritability and reddening of the eyes.

Those that on a regular basis function with organophosphates and carbamates need to consider having periodic cholinesterase tests. The blood cholinesterase examination gauges the effect of exposure to organophosphate and carbamate pesticides.


Also marginal exposure to cholinesterase preventions can present a considerable risk to these individuals. Baseline screening must constantly be done during the time of year when pesticides are not being made use of, or at least 30 days from the most recent exposure - exterminator. Establishing a standard worth often requires two examinations executed at the very least 72 hours apart however within 14 days of each various other


Cholinesterase examinations can be repeated during times when organophosphate and carbamate insecticides are being used and afterwards contrasted with the standard level. The objective of routine cholinesterase tracking is to allow a medical professional to identify the incident of too much exposure to organophosphates and carbamates. If a research laboratory examination reveals a cholinesterase decline of 30 percent below the established standard, the employee needs to be retested quickly.


Your primary care medical professional can assist to develop the frequency of this screening program. As pointed out previously, the danger or danger involved with making use of a chemical relies on both the toxicity of the item and the quantity of exposure to the item (Risk = Poisoning x Exposure). Ideally, make use of a low-toxicity product when possible, however even they can be damaging if your direct exposure degree is high.
